Providian - Credit Protection |
||||||||||||||
|
We realized that over $400 of unauthorized credit protection coverage had been charged to our platinum account. We called this to the attention of Providian and were told a credit would immediately be given in that amount. We were left with the clear impression that a payment would not be due in the near future due to the credit adjustment to our account. In fact, my husband said, "We don't have to make a payment any time soon because of the credit adjustment." Within a couple of weeks we were recieved a letter, (today), stating that our account had been closed and that the only way to reopen it would be to pay the card in full. My husband is very proud of his credit rating. He has excellent credit, any cards he has are platinum, so he did not want a derogatory mark on his credit rating. We called Providian immediately and yes, they said they would credit our account for the unauthorized charges of 400+ -- but that it doesn't show up as a PAYMENT credit, so they closed our account...and are demanding the account balance in full! Baloney! They over charged us for an unauthorized fee! Report Your Experience
